It's Country Calendar's fortieth anniversary, making it New Zealand's longest running television series by a country mile. What better way to celebrate this event than to release a double DVD of selected stories from this much loved TVNZ programme.
Included is an hour-long special feature which traces the history of Country Calendar's earliest days through to the present and yes, excerpts from those famous spoofs are there – the radio-controlled dog and the fence-playing farmer!
You can also enjoy stories from the latest series: the Port Waikato seventy year old who breeds rodeo bulls; the fifteen year old twins who manage a North Island hill country station; the Northland couple who have transformed a gorse-covered farmlet into an organic paradise; the Aucklander who bought a South Island high country station are all featured.
